📌  相关文章
📜  在 Julia 中检查一个数字是否为偶数 – iseven() 方法(1)

📅  最后修改于: 2023-12-03 15:37:22.742000             🧑  作者: Mango

在 Julia 中检查一个数字是否为偶数 – iseven() 方法

在 Julia 中,我们可以使用内置的 iseven() 函数来检查一个数字是否为偶数。

iseven() 函数返回 true(表示数字为偶数)或 false(表示数字为奇数)。

以下是 iseven() 函数的使用方法和示例:

# 检查数字是否为偶数
iseven(4)      # 返回 true
iseven(3)      # 返回 false

# 检查变量是否为偶数
x = 6
iseven(x)      # 返回 true
y = 9
iseven(y)      # 返回 false

iseven() 函数还可以用于检查像数组、向量或矩阵等结构中的元素是否为偶数。

以下是 iseven() 函数在数组中的示例:

# 检查数组中的元素是否为偶数
a = [1, 2, 3, 4, 5]
iseven.(a)     # 返回 [false, true, false, true, false]

在上面的示例中,我们使用了点语法来在数组中逐个元素地应用 iseven() 函数。必须在函数名后面加上一个点号才能启用点语法。

此外,我们还可以使用逻辑运算符 . 来将两个数组中的元素进行比较,以判断它们是否相等。 这样,我们就可以比较两个数组中的元素是否都是偶数:

# 比较两个数组中的元素是否都是偶数
a = [2, 4, 6, 8, 10]
b = [1, 4, 6, 8, 11]
iseven.(a) .== iseven.(b)   # 返回 [false, true, true, true, false]

在上面的示例中,我们使用了 . 来比较 a 数组和 b 数组中的元素是否都是偶数。如果两个元素都是偶数,则返回 true,否则返回 false

在 Julia 中,检查数字是否为偶数是一项普遍的任务。如果您需要在 Julia 中检查数字是否为偶数,请使用内置的 iseven() 函数。